2026.01.10 Sat
水戸西教室

【プロ基礎】プログラミングの要!「条件分岐」でロボットに判断力を 2025.9.14

今回の基礎クラスでは、プログラミングをする上で「なくてはならないモノ」を学びました。 それは【IFコマンド】です。

前回学んだ「変数」と、今回の「IFコマンド(条件分岐)」。 実は、世の中で動いているあらゆるプログラムのほとんどが、この2つの組み合わせで成り立っていると言っても過言ではありません。
ロボットが自分で状況判断をして動くための、いわば「脳みそ」を作るような作業です。

 

今回は数字がたくさん出てくるため、生徒たちも「うーん…」と悪戦苦闘。 それでも、「ここをこう変えたらどうなる?」と粘り強く取り組む姿が印象的でした。

最短ルートで書くことが全てではありません。
まずは泥臭くても「意図した通りに動かす」という成功体験を積み重ねることが大切です。

最後は、条件分岐を使ったゲームで対戦。
キーを連打して、パワーを溜めカムロボを前進させるゲームです。
ですが、キーを押しすぎるとカムロボが動かず、他の生徒に遅れをとることに!ギリギリを攻める度胸が必要です。